NHTSA’s rear-view mandate spurs criticism

Is NHTSA's rear-view technology ruling a step forwards or backwards for the regulator?

The National Highway Traffic Safety Administration’s (NHTSA) recent announcement of a ruling requiring rear-view cameras on all cars and light-duty trucks has met criticism from certain camps, which believe rather than moving forward with safety improvements, the organisation is instead taking a big step backwards.
